Three of my favorite guys I've DJ'd with over the last few years got together over the weekend at Plastic People in the UK to play some heavy vinyl goodness from Jazz to Soul, US to Brazil, Disco and Boogie audio richness. The sound system at Plastic People is world class, and apparently they were using some high end audiophile turntables that do not have pitch control, because it's all about the focus on the sound quality. Like a sock hop, or The Loft, there isn't really mixing, but programming and presenting the beautiful tunes in all their black wax glory. The tunes are top notch of course, and the extra bonus is hearing the crowd cheer in the background. Just close your eyes and you can almost feel like you are there. Gladys Knight - It's A Better Than Good Time (Walter Gibbons unreleased Acetate Edit)



In my opinion this is the shiniest jewel in the glorious crown that Walter wears while DJ'ing that big club in the sky. I won't back away from hyperbole as this is truly one of the greatest Disco mixes of all time. Spliced with tape, this astonishing mix is equally lush with orchestration and Gladys' vocals, as much as it is explosive with its drum breaks and breakdowns. This mix serves as a testament to the visionary talents of Walter Gibbons and the endless possibilities within this craft of Disco mixing and editing.
